Abstract

Tracker is one of the tools found at the Ground Control Station (GCS). GCS itself can be interpreted as an aircraft control station, quadcopter, Unmanned Aerial Vehicle (UAV), or other flying objects operating on the earth's surface, either on land or on ships. In tracking operation, a control device is needed to control the servo movement. operate the tracker using the MPU6050 Sensor as a servo motor control to follow changes in the angular speed of the object, and the GPS module GY-GPS6MV2 to determine the position of the object's coordinates. The average MPU6050 sensor reading at 0 ° is 1.35 ° for x angle, -0.92 ° for y angle, and 0.22 ° for z angle. The average reading for 30 ° is 30.61 ° for x angle, 29.83 ° for y angle, and 30.11 for z angle. The mean reading at 45 ° is 45.34 ° for x angle, 45.33 ° for y angle, and 45.08 ° for z angle. The average reading for 60 ° is 60.90 ° for x angle, 60.62 ° for y angle, and 60.07 for z angle.
